Technology has transformed countless industries – and the world of finance is no exception. Despite pandemic-induced delays, 2021 was the start of huge growth for the fintech industry.
The financial world has experienced a tumultuous few years with the neverending innovative growth and development of technology. Fintech is a portmanteau for "financial technology." It's a catch-all term for technology used to augment, streamline, digitize or disrupt. Mobile fintech technology is changing how payments connect globally. The future of fintech is promising. Monzo is an online bank and was one of the earliest new app-based challenger banks in the UK. Monzo is digital-only and has been built to make users' spending and saving habits more manageable.
The popular bank lives in an app. It prioritises user experience, helping its customers budget better, have stress-free spending abroad and even helps them earn interest.
Monzo's features offer full financial visibility, with their bank accounts and credit cards stored all in one place.
Monzo is a future-focused bank, that believes that traditional banking methods are a thing of the past. Monzo intends to focus on solving its users' issues, rather than acting as a platform that is purely interested in the selling of financial products.
Atom Bank was founded in 2014 as the UK's first app-only bank. It serves as a digital-only financial company and 'challenger bank', built to prioritise consumer needs.
Being mobile-only Atom Bank allows its customers to start up accounts with a mobile application and provides them with that much-needed full access to all of their financial information.
Atom bank, the UK's first app-based bank is set on doing the right thing for its customers. Its main aim is to stand up against the big banks and not waste the precious time of its customers.
Atom Bank prioritises three specific areas; saving, buying and growing. Banking is changing for the better and Atom Bank aims to be one of the first to help bring about this change.
